One solution is to place one or more rectangular or round air duct noise silencers between the fan and the occupied spaces. Hvac dampers for air ducts are usually located between the main trunk line and the round supply duct. Air duct noise silencers, also known as industrial sound attenuators, sound traps, or mufflers, are specifically designed to control airborne sound waves resonating within ducts, openings in buildings, enclosures, or from noisy equipment.
